• 제목/요약/키워드: graph construction

검색결과 201건 처리시간 0.028초

일반적 네트워크에서의 결함허용 시스템 구성 알고리즘에 관한 연구 (A Study on Fault-Tolerant System Construction Algorithm in General Network)

  • 문윤호;김병기
    • 한국통신학회논문지
    • /
    • 제23권6호
    • /
    • pp.1538-1545
    • /
    • 1998
  • 시스템의 신뢰성은 디지털 컴퓨터 시대가 시작된 이래 가장 중요한 관심사가 되어 왔다. 신뢰성을 증가시키는 가장 최근 방법 중 하나는 결함허용 시스템을 고안하는 것이다. 본 논문에서는 일반적 그래프 형태에 대해 결함 허용 시스템의 구성방법을 제안하였다. 이 시스템은 여러 개의 예비 노드를 가진다. 최근까지 결함허용 시스템 고안은 루프 형태와 트리 형태의 네트워크에서만 작용되어 왔다. 그러나 그것들은 매우 제한적인 경우이다. 본문의 알고리즘은 그러한 많은 제약을 가지지 않고서 어느 유형이든 적용될 수 있는 융통성을 갖도록 시도되었다. 이 알고리즘은 여러 단계로 구성되는데 최소 직경 스패닝 트리의 검출 단계, 최적 노드 결정 단계, 원래의 연결성 복구 단계 및 최종적으로 중복 그래프의 구성 단계이다.

  • PDF

Esterel에서 근사-제어 흐름그래프의 효율적인 생성 (Efficient Construction of Over-approximated CFG on Esterel)

  • 김철주;윤정한;서선애;최광무;한태숙
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제15권11호
    • /
    • pp.876-880
    • /
    • 2009
  • 프로그램에 대한 자료흐름분석(data flow analysis)를 수행하기 위해서는 입력된 프로그램에 대응하는 제어흐름그래프(control flow graph)가 필요하다. 본 논문에서는 동기(synchronous)식 절차(imperative)형 언어 중 하나인 Esterel로 작성된 프로그램에 대해서 단순하면서 입력 프로그램의 구조와 흡사한 형태로 표현되는 근사-제어흐름그래프(over-approximated CFG) 생성방법을 제안한다. 제안된 방법을 이용하면 병렬 제어흐름을 표현하는 부분에서 실행 불가능한 경우까지 포함할 수 있다. 그렇지만, 생성방법이 직관적이고, 실제 수행경로를 모두 포함하기 때문에 다른 분석을 수행하는데 매우 적차하다.

그래프 컨벌루션 네트워크 기반 주거지역 감시시스템의 얼굴인식 알고리즘 개선 (Improvement of Face Recognition Algorithm for Residential Area Surveillance System Based on Graph Convolution Network)

  • 담하의;민병원
    • 사물인터넷융복합논문지
    • /
    • 제10권2호
    • /
    • pp.1-15
    • /
    • 2024
  • 스마트 지역사회의 구축은 지역사회의 안전을 보장하는 새로운 방법이자 중요한 조치이다. 촬영 각도로 인한 얼굴 기형 및 기타 외부 요인의 영향으로 인한 신원 인식 정확도 문제를 해결하기 위해 이 논문에서는 네트워크 모델을 구축할 때 전체 그래프 컨벌루션 모델을 설계하고, 그래프 컨벌루션 모델에 협력하여 얼굴의 핵심을 추출한다. 또한 얼굴의 핵심을 특정 규칙에 따라 핵심 포인트를 구축하며 이미지 컨벌루션 구조를 구축한 후 이미지 컨벌루션 모델을 추가하여 이미지 특징의 핵심을 개선한다. 마지막으로 두 사람의 얼굴의 이미지 특징 텐서를 계산하고 전체 연결 레이어를 사용하여 집계된 특징을 추출하고 판별하여 인원의 신원이 동일한지 여부를 결정한다. 최종적으로 다양한 실험과 테스트를 거쳐 이 글에서 설계한 네트워크의 얼굴 핵심 포인트에 대한 위치 정확도 AUC 지표는 300W 오픈 소스 데이터 세트에서 85.65%에 도달했다. 자체 구축 데이터 세트에서 88.92% 증가했다. 얼굴 인식 정확도 측면에서 이 글에서 제안한 IBUG 오픈 소스 데이터 세트에서 네트워크의 인식 정확도는 83.41% 증가했으며 자체 구축 데이터 세트의 인식 정확도는 96.74% 증가했다. 실험 결과는 이 글에서 설계된 네트워크가 얼굴을 모니터링하는 데 더 높은 탐지 및 인식 정확도를 가지고 있음을 보여준다.

A CONSTRUCTION OF ONE-FACTORIZATION

  • Choi, Yoon-Young;Kim, Sang-Mok;Lim, Seon-Ju;Park, Bong-Joo
    • 대한수학회지
    • /
    • 제45권5호
    • /
    • pp.1243-1253
    • /
    • 2008
  • In this paper, we construct one-factorizations of given complete graphs of even order. These constructions partition the edges of the complete graph into one-factors and triples. Our new constructions of one-factors and triples can be applied to a recursive construction of Steiner triple systems for all possible orders ${\geq}$15.

초등학생들의 과학 선 그래프 작성 및 해석 과정 분석 (Analysis of Children's Constructing and Interpreting of a Line Graph in Science)

  • 양수진;장명덕
    • 한국초등과학교육학회지:초등과학교육
    • /
    • 제31권3호
    • /
    • pp.321-333
    • /
    • 2012
  • The purpose of this study was to examine elementary school students' characteristics and difficulties in drawing and interpreting a line graph, and to present educational implications. Twenty five students(4th grader: 6, 5th grader: 9, and 6th grader: 10) at an elementary school participated in this study. We used a student's task which was about graphing on a given data table and interpreting his/her graph. The data table was on heating 200mL and 500mL of water and measuring their temperature at regular time intervals. We collected multiple source of data, and data analyzed based on the sub-variables of TOGS. The some results of this study are as follows: First, five children (20.0%), especially two of 10 sixth graders (20.0%), could not construct a line graph about a given data table. Second, twenty students (80.0%) had the ability on 'Scaling axes' and on 'Assigning variables to the axes', however, only a student understood why the time is on the longitudinal axis and the temperature is on the vertical axis. Third, in the case of 'Plotting points', twelve children (48.0%) could drew two graphs on a coordinate. Fourth, in the case of 'Selecting the corresponding value for Y (or X)', twenty student had little difficulty. on 'Describing the relationship between variables', seventeen students (68.0%) understood the relationship between time and temperature of water, and the relationship between temperature and amount of water. Finally, eleven students (44%) had the ability on 'Interrelating and extrapolation graphs.' Educational implications are also presented in this paper.

산업용 무선 센서 네트워크에서의 기계학습 기반 이동성 지원 방안 (Mobility Support Scheme Based on Machine Learning in Industrial Wireless Sensor Network)

  • 김상대;김천용;조현종;정관수;오승민
    • 정보처리학회논문지:컴퓨터 및 통신 시스템
    • /
    • 제9권11호
    • /
    • pp.256-264
    • /
    • 2020
  • 산업용 무선 센서 네트워크는 여러 산업 분야에서의 생산성 향상, 비용 절감 등을 위해 사용되고 있으며, 저지연, 고신뢰 데이터 전송과 같은 성능을 요구한다. 이를 달성하기 위해서, 산업용 무선 센서 네트워크에서는 네트워크 매니저를 통해 네트워크 위상에 대한 그래프 생성 및 자원 할당을 수행하여, 각 장치의 전송 주기 및 경로를 미리 결정한다. 하지만, 이러한 네트워크 관리 방법은 네트워크 위상 변화 시에 그래프 재생성 및 자원 재할당을 수행해야 하므로, 잦은 위상 변화가 발생하는 네트워크 환경에서는 관리비용 증가와 요구성능의 일시적 저하와 같은 현상이 발생하므로 적합하지 않다. 즉, 최근에 다양한 이동 장치를 활용하는 산업용 무선 센서 네트워크에서는 이동 장치로 인한 경로 단절 및 경로 재구성 과정에서 발생하는 지연 전송과 전송 신뢰성 저하를 방지할 수 있는 네트워크 관리 방안에 관한 연구가 필요하다. 본 논문에서는 기계학습을 이용하여 이동 장치의 시간별 위치 및 이동 주기를 분석하고, 이에 기반한 이동 패턴을 추출한다. 또한, 추출된 이동 패턴 정보를 기반으로 예측되는 시간별 네트워크 위상에 대한 그래프 생성 및 자원 할당을 수행하는 네트워크 관리 기능을 제안함으로써, 이동 장치의 이동으로 인한 성능 저하의 문제를 방지한다. 성능평가 결과는 제안 방안이 추출한 이동 패턴과 실제 이동 패턴을 비교하였을 때 약 86%의 예측 정확도를 보이고, 기존의 방법에 비해 높은 전송 성공률 및 낮은 자원 점유율의 성능을 보여준다.

마감공사 생산성 향상을 위한 리프트 카 최적배치 모델 (Optimum Layout Model of Lift Car for Improving Productivity in High-rise Building Exterior Finishing Work)

  • 이동민;임현수;김태훈;조훈희;강경인
    • 한국건축시공학회:학술대회논문집
    • /
    • 한국건축시공학회 2013년도 춘계 학술논문 발표대회
    • /
    • pp.171-172
    • /
    • 2013
  • An operation planning of lift car is crucial in tall building construction especially it's arrangement plans, because it is related with transportation distance of finishing materials affecting construction productivity. Since tall building construction, composed of complicating and huge plane have complex traffic lines of finishing materials, to determine the position of lift car empirically or intuitively has limits. Therefore this paper suggest an optimum layout model of lift car minimizing the transportation distance both at site-level and floor-level using Graph theory and Dijkstra algorithm.

  • PDF

BIM 모델 내 공간의 시멘틱 무결성 검증을 위한 그래프 기반 딥러닝 모델 구축에 관한 연구 (Development of Graph based Deep Learning methods for Enhancing the Semantic Integrity of Spaces in BIM Models)

  • 이원복;김시현;유영수;구본상
    • 한국건설관리학회논문집
    • /
    • 제23권3호
    • /
    • pp.45-55
    • /
    • 2022
  • BIM의 도입에 따라 공간이 개별 객체로 인식되면서 객체화된 공간의 속성정보는 법규검토, 에너지 분석, 피난 경로 분석 등을 위한 기반 데이터로 사용 가능하기에 BIM의 활용성을 넓힐 수 있는 발판을 마련하였다. 그러나 BIM 모델 내 개별 공간 속성의 오기입이나 누락이 없는 시멘틱 무결성(semantic integrity)이 보장되어야 하는데, 다수의 참여자에 의한 수작업으로 진행되는 BIM 모델링 과정 특성 상 설계 오류가 빈번히 발생한다는 문제점이 존재한다. 이를 해결하기 위해 BIM 모델의 공간 정합성 검증을 위한 연구가 다수 진행되었으나, 적용 범위가 한정적이거나 분류 정확도가 낮은 한계점이 존재하였다. 본 연구에서는 공간의 기하정보 뿐 아니라 BIM 모델 내 공간과 부재 간 연결 관계를 Graph Convolutional Networks (GCN) 학습과정에 활용하여 향상된 성능의 공간 자동 분류모델을 구축하고자 하였다. 구축된 GCN 기반 모델의 성능을 공간의 기하정보만으로 학습된 기계학습 모델인 Multi-Layer Perceptron (MLP)과 비교하여 공간 분류 시 연결 관계 적용의 효용성을 검증하고자 하였다. 이를 통해 관계정보 활용 시 약 8% 내외 수준으로 공간 분류 성능이 향상되는 것으로 확인되었다.

Efficient Graph Construction and User Movement Path for Fast Inspection of Virus and Stable Management System

  • Kim, Jong-Hyun
    • 한국컴퓨터정보학회논문지
    • /
    • 제27권8호
    • /
    • pp.135-142
    • /
    • 2022
  • 본 논문에서는 위급한 상황(예 : COVID-19)에서 바이러스 검사를 빠르게 진행하기 위한 그래프 기반 사용자 경로 제어와 이것을 도시 맵에서 시뮬레이션을 할 수 있는 프레임워크를 제안한다. 가상환경에서 많이 활용되는 길찾기(Pathfinding) 알고리즘인 A*나 네비게이션 메쉬 자료구조는 정해진 정적 이동 경로만을 안내하기 때문에 가상환경에서 에이전트를 제어하는 CS(Computer science)문제에 적용할 할 경우 효율적이다. 하지만, 실제 COVID-19 환경에 적용하여 문제를 풀기에는 충분하지 않다. 특히, 빠른 바이러스 검사를 받기 위해서는 짧은 거리만을 이용하는 게 아닌, 실제 도로 교통상황, 병원의 크기, 환자 이동 수, 환자 처리 시간 등 고려해야 할 상황들이 많다. 본 논문에서는 위에서 언급한 다양한 속성들과 이를 이용한 최적화 함수를 모델링하여, 실제 도시 맵에서 바이러스 검사를 빠르고 효율적으로 처리할 수 있고, 다양한 상황을 디지털 트윈 방식으로 시뮬레이션을 할 수 있는 프레임워크를 제안한다.

출발점과 목표점을 일반화 가시성그래프로 표현된 맵에 포함하기 위한 빠른 알고리즘 (Fast algorithm for incorporating start and goal points into the map represented in a generalized visibility graph)

  • 유견아;전현주
    • 한국시뮬레이션학회논문지
    • /
    • 제15권2호
    • /
    • pp.31-39
    • /
    • 2006
  • 가시성그래프는 최소 탐색 공간으로 게임환경을 모델링하여 효과적으로 길을 찾을 수 있도록 하는 방법으로 잘 알려져 있다. 일반화 가시성그래프는 가시성그래프의 가장 큰 단점으로 지적되는 "벽-껴안기" 문제를 해결하기 위해 확장된 장애물의 경계 위에 생성된 가시성그래프이다. 일반화 가시성그래프에 의해 구해진 경로는 근사 최적이며 자연스럽게 보이는 장점이 있다. 본 논문에서는 변화하는 출발점과 목표점과 정적인 장애물 사이를 움직이는 게임 캐릭터에 효과적으로 일반화 가시성그래프를 적용하는 방법을 제안한다. 일반화 가시성그래프는 일단 생성되면 최소 탐색공간을 보장하지만 그 생성 자체는 노드사이의 링크의 교차 여부론 일일이 체크하여야 하므로 시간이 많이 소요된다. 아이디어는 먼저 정적인 장애물만으로 지도를 생성해 놓고 출발점과 목표점을 빠르게 포함시키는 것이다. 출발점과 목표점의 포함 부분이 여러 번 반복되어야 하는 과정이므로 출발점과 목표점을 빠르게 포함시키는데에 연산 기하학 분야의 회전 plane-sweep 알고리즘을 이용할 것을 제안한다. 시뮬레이션 결과는 전체 그래프를 매번 생성하는 것보다 제안한 방법의 실행시간이 39%-68% 정도 향상되었음을 보여준다.

  • PDF